Overview

Providing 9 rooms, the 3-star Ayr Gatehouse Hotel is about 6 km from Robert Burns Birthplace Museum. This Ayr guest house offers parking on site.

Location

While staying in the property, you are invited to discover Ayr Beach, located around 10 minutes away by car, or visit sports venues like Belleisle Golf Club, which is around 10 minutes away by car. Auld Brig Museum in Ayr is relatively close to the hotel. Explore the historical sights of Ayr, starting with Greenan Castle situated around 10 minutes away by car.

There is Hunters Dr/East Park Rd bus stop at a 450-metre distance from Ayr Gatehouse Hotel.
